The Tecno Camon 15 is Available on Pre-Order in Kenya

Tecno Camon 15

Tecno is planning to launch its latest smartphone in Kenya in the coming weeks. This new smartphone is the Tecno Camon 15 that takes over from the Camon 12 that I reviewed last year. The Camon 15 will be available in three variants, the Camon 15 premier, Camon 15 and Camon 15 air.

Just like all other Camon devices, the Tecno Camon 15 is a camera centric smartphone. The phone will be coming to Kenya early next month, on April 10. Its retail price is still unknown but we will have that information in the coming weeks. Check out the video below.

The Tecno Camon 15 will be the first smartphone from the company to launch in the country in 2020. It is also the company’s first smartphone with a pop-up selfie camera. With this camera, expect no notch and very thin bezels on the display.

Even though the retail price of the Camon 15 is still unknown, you can pre-order the phone in Kenya right now. Those who wish to do so will be required to pay Ksh 2,000 as a deposit and add the rest when the phone is finally unveiled. In the end, those who pre-order the Camon 15 in Kenya will pay Ksh 2,000 less when picking up the phone.

Once the payment has been made the customer will receive a shopping voucher (Tuskys voucher) worth ksh.1000 within 12 hours or almost immediately.

At the moment, you can pre-order the Tecno Camon 15 through offline stores only. There is no option to do so online. There are a number of stores to pre-order the phone through. Most of these are Tecno branded retail stores that you can walk in and ask for more information on how to pre-order.

Below are some of the key specifications of the Tecno Camon 15.

Display: 6.55-inch IPS LCD display with 720 x 1600 pixels resolution
Processor:  MediaTek Helio P35
RAM: 4GB
Storage: 64 GB internal storage, expdandable
Cameras: 64MP quad rear camera, 16 MP front-facing camera
SIM: dual SIM
Battery: 4,000/ 5,000 mAh battery
Android:  Android 10.0; HIOS 6.0
